I coined the term 'satiricom' in 2021 as a contraction of 'satirical comment', which I like as it's virtually the same sound as 'Satyricon' as in both The Romans' "The Book of Satyrlike Adventures" and Fellini's 1969 movie. From 21-22 I created text and images for 6 satiricoms, which were posted on various social media sites, so in 2024 I decided to create a video of them and composed this music for the video, though this is an improved remix of the original;.

From my Timeline notes:
Horns are a hybrid of Big Band Shout 11 part Horns & Crooner Big Band 9 part Horns samples, but as the centre part is way louder than what precedes and follows it, I had to cut the hybrid sample into 4, then decrease and increase the db of each section as needed. I also did a 1 second adjustable fade 1:35-1:36 to kill a single way too deep note.

84 bars; 4/4, G; tempo 110; Time 3:12
